At Ohio State University, we offer undergraduate, master’s and doctoral programs. The bachelor’s and master’s programs emphasize developing planners for professional practice through real-world experiences. The doctoral program focuses on expanding knowledge of planning to improve the profession. Our students are among the best in the world, and the opportunities for learning are endless.
